In the field of art,color matching is widely used in a variety of artistic design,such as image,poster,clothing and interior design.Among them,harmonious color matching is often a decisive factor for the popularity of a design.Although artists have never stopped the research of color harmony,the current color harmony theory only provides a limited number of harmonious color combinations,and the public without knowledge of color harmony cannot quickly select harmonious color combinations and apply them to appropriate scenes.In recent years,with the continuous improvement of computer performance and the rapid development of the field of computer vision,researchers began to use computer vision methods to deal with outstanding problems in other disciplines.On the one hand,people set up large-scale websites for users to share harmonious color matching.Users can refer to published color matching schemes,or upload harmonious color matching conforming to their own aesthetics.On the other hand,people collect data from these websites to build datasets.On this basis,they use machine learning methods to build models to predict the degree of color harmony,quantifying the fuzzy concept of color harmony into an intuitive standard.However,the existing methods have two main problems.First,the color features from the dataset do not reflect users’ preference for different colors;Second,the influence of different users’ aesthetic preferences on color harmony should be considered in the model.In view of the above problems,this paper begins to study the harmony algorithm of the five-color themes.Our main contributions are summarized as follows:In this paper,we propose a color harmony evaluation method based on color-pair to accurately evaluate color theme harmony.First,we use the method of two-layer maximum likelihood estimation(MLE)to predict the color harmony by statistical modeling the paired color preference of the existing dataset.Then,the preliminary prediction results were refined by back-propagation neural network(BPNN),and various color features were extracted from different color spaces to obtain accurate harmony estimation.In order to consider the influence of different users’ aesthetic preferences on color harmony,this paper proposes a color harmony estimation model based on crowdsourcing.By establishing a probability model between the hidden layer and the output layer of BPNN,the distribution parameters of different users’ aesthetic cognition were obtained,and the harmony estimation was obtained by applying the model to the training of BPNN.Through this color harmony estimation model,we try to reveal the relationship between different users’ aesthetic cognition and color harmony.In this paper,we hope to promote the development of related research fields through the research on the harmony degree algorithm of five-color color themes,such as the rapid assessment of the color harmony degree of an image,and the one-click color change in scenes such as clothing,home,3D model,etc.,according to the different needs of users.
